JSC2006-E-40786 (20 Sept. 2006) --- At the Russian Mission Control Center outside Moscow, Hamid Ansari (left) talks on the phone with his wife, Anousheh Ansari, during her first moments onboard the International Space Station. Ansari and the Expedition 14 crew docked to the International Space Station Wednesday, September 20, 2006. A Soyuz TMA-9 spacecraft lifted off from the Baikonur Cosmodrome in Kazakhstan Sept. 18, 2006 with astronaut Michael E. Lopez-Alegria, Expedition 14 commander and NASA ISS science officer; cosmonaut Mikhail Tyurin, Soyuz commander and Expedition 14 flight engineer; along with American businesswoman Ansari, who will spend nine days on the station under a commercial agreement with the Russian Federal Space Agency.
